Pianist Ingi Bjarni Skúlason leads a quintet through his original music. The concert will feature music from his quintet albums Tenging (2019) and Farfuglar (2023). It will also include material from his new quartet album Hope (2025), released earlier this year. Ingi Bjarni has performed his own compositions with a wide range of musicians in Iceland, Japan, and across Europe, published sheet music, and more. He has received significant attention and recognition for his albums, all of which have been positively reviewed in international media. At the 2025 Icelandic Music Awards, he won the award for Jazz Composition of the Year 2024. He was also nominated as Jazz Performer of the Year and for Jazz Album of the Year.
